400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> word > 文章详情

plc中什么是word

作者:路由通
|
373人看过
发布时间:2025-09-17 20:34:00
标签:
在可编程逻辑控制器系统中,字(Word)是数据存储和处理的基本单元,通常由16位二进制数构成,用于表示数值、指令或状态信息。它作为寄存器操作的核心载体,直接影响逻辑控制精度与通信效率,是工业自动化领域的关键基础概念。
plc中什么是word

       在工业自动化控制领域,可编程逻辑控制器作为核心控制设备,其数据存储和处理机制直接决定了系统性能。其中,字(Word)作为基本数据单元,承载着从数字运算到设备通信的关键职能。理解字的本质,不仅是掌握可编程逻辑控制器编程技术的基础,更是实现精准工业控制的必要条件。

       字的核心定义与物理本质

       字在可编程逻辑控制器系统中指代具有固定长度的二进制数据单元,通常由16个连续位(Bit)组成。每个位代表一个二进制状态(0或1),而16个位的组合可表示0至65535范围内的无符号整数,或通过补码形式表示-32768至32767的有符号整数。这种数据结构直接对应可编程逻辑控制器内部寄存器的物理存储单元,是处理器进行算术运算和逻辑处理的最小可操作单位。

       字与存储器的映射关系

       在可编程逻辑控制器存储器结构中,字通过地址进行寻址操作。每个字单元占据两个连续字节(Byte)的存储空间,其中低字节存放低位数据,高字节存放高位数据,这种排列方式符合小端字节序规范。例如在保持寄存器中,地址40001代表第一个字存储单元,其数据可通过移动指令或功能码进行读写操作。

       数据类型与数值表示

       字的数值表达能力远超基本整数范畴。通过不同的解析方式,单个字可表示布尔量集合(16个独立开关状态)、BCD码(二进制编码的十进制数)、ASCII字符对(两个文本字符)或标准化工程值。在过程控制中,字经常通过缩放变换将原始数据转换为实际物理量,如将0-32767的整数值对应到0-100摄氏度的温度测量范围。

       字在指令系统中的角色

       可编程逻辑控制器的指令集深度依赖字单元进行操作。移动指令(如MOV)实现字单元间的数据传递,算术指令(ADD、SUB)对字数据进行计算,比较指令(CMP)进行字单元数值关系判断。这些指令通过改变字的状态来实现控制逻辑,例如通过比较温度测量字与设定值字的大小关系触发冷却设备启停。

       双字与浮点数的关联

       当处理更大数值或精度要求更高的数据时,两个连续字可组合形成双字(Double Word)单元。32位双字不仅能表示更大范围的整数值(0至4294967295),更重要的是可通过IEEE754标准格式表示单精度浮点数。这种机制使得可编程逻辑控制器能够处理带小数点的工程数据,如压力、流量等模拟量的精确控制。

       通信协议中的字传输

       在工业通信网络中,字作为基本数据传输单元发挥着关键作用。Modbus协议通过保持寄存器读写功能码(03/06/16)实现字数据的远程访问,Profibus-DP协议以字为单位组织过程数据交换,以太网协议则通过TCP帧封装字数据包。这种标准化传输机制确保了不同厂商设备间的数据 interoperability。

       字与输入输出模块的交互

       数字量输入输出模块通常以字为单位进行数据映射。16点直流输入模块将外部传感器状态映射到输入映像寄存器的一个字中,每个位对应一个具体输入点。同样,模拟量模块将采集的12/16位分辨率数据转换为整数字数值存入指定存储区,供程序调用处理。

       编程环境中的字操作

       在集成开发环境中,字变量通过符号表进行声明和管理。程序员可定义具有实际意义的变量名(如"温度设定值")关联到具体存储地址,并通过功能块图、梯形图或结构化文本语言进行字操作。现代编程平台还提供数据类型检查机制,防止对字单元进行错误的位级或字节级访问。

       字处理的最佳实践

       高效的字数据处理需要遵循特定规范。重要参数应实施冗余存储,将关键数据同时保存在两个独立字单元中;对于多字组成的数组数据,需确保地址连续性以避免内存碎片;通信传输前应对字数据实施异或校验或循环冗余校验,保证数据传输完整性。

       故障诊断与字数据监控

       字单元的状态监控是系统调试和故障排查的重要手段。通过在线监视功能,工程师可实时观察关键字的数值变化趋势,结合强制写入操作进行逻辑验证。历史数据记录功能通常以字为单位存储过程变量,为后续的性能分析和优化提供数据支撑。

       跨平台兼容性考量

       不同制造商的可编程逻辑控制器产品在字处理上存在细微差异。某些平台支持字内的位寻址(如西门子允许V10.2的寻址方式),而其他系统要求先移动字到中间寄存器再进行位操作。在进行多平台项目开发时,需要特别注意这些实现差异带来的编程适配问题。

       性能优化策略

       字操作效率直接影响程序扫描周期时间。批量字传输指令(块移动)比单个字操作更高效,字对齐访问比非对齐访问更快,经常访问的字数据应放置在快速存储区。这些优化措施在大型控制系统中有助于显著提升整体运行性能。

       安全机制与保护

       关键工艺参数对应的字单元需要实施写保护机制。通过设置写使能条件、增加权限验证或配置硬件锁等措施,防止未经授权的修改。安全可编程逻辑控制器还采用签名校验机制,确保重要字数据在传输过程中不被篡改。

       未来发展趋势

       随着工业物联网技术发展,字数据的应用正超越传统控制范畴。通过边缘计算网关,可编程逻辑控制器中的字数据可直接推送至云平台进行大数据分析,实现预测性维护和能源优化。同时,时间敏感网络技术正在提升字数据在工业以太网中的传输确定性。

       深刻理解字的特性和应用方法,不仅能提升可编程逻辑控制器编程效率,更能为构建稳定可靠的工业自动化系统奠定坚实基础。随着工业技术不断发展,字作为数据承载核心的地位仍将持续深化,只是表现形式和应用场景将更加丰富多元。

相关文章
什么是word版讲稿
本文深入探讨了Word版讲稿的定义、功能、应用场景及实用技巧。通过引用官方权威资料和真实案例,详细解析了如何利用Word软件创建高效讲稿,涵盖核心功能、优势分析、创建步骤、模板使用等12个核心论点。文章旨在帮助读者全面掌握Word讲稿的制作方法,提升演讲和专业文档处理能力。
2025-09-17 20:33:14
151人看过
为什么word不能注册
本文深入探讨了词语在注册过程中受限的多重原因,包括法律法规、商标风险、技术限制等,结合官方案例解析,帮助用户理解注册规则背后的逻辑与实用性。
2025-09-17 20:33:07
305人看过
word字体为什么很少
本文深入分析了Microsoft Word中字体选择较少的多方面原因,涵盖版权限制、系统兼容性、软件设计、用户需求等核心因素。通过引用官方资料和实际案例,如字体版权争议和跨平台问题,揭示技术、商业及用户体验的深层影响,帮助用户理解这一现象。
2025-09-17 20:32:54
194人看过
word倒页指什么
Word倒页功能是Microsoft Word中的一项实用特性,指文档页面以倒序方式显示或打印的操作。本文将全面解析其定义、设置方法、应用场景及优缺点,并引用官方资料和真实案例,帮助用户高效利用这一功能,提升文档处理效率。
2025-09-17 20:32:53
165人看过
word上面都有什么栏
Microsoft Word作为全球最流行的文字处理软件,其界面设计精良,包含了多个功能栏位,如标题栏、功能区、状态栏等,这些栏位协同工作,提供文档编辑、格式设置和协作功能。本文将基于Microsoft官方文档,深入解析每个栏位的作用、使用案例,并分享实用技巧,帮助用户提升办公效率。
2025-09-17 20:32:52
319人看过
word小标题是什么
在微软Word文档处理软件中,小标题是用于划分内容层级的结构化元素,它通过格式化样式实现章节划分和导航功能,既能提升文档美观度,又能通过自动生成目录等高级功能大幅提升长文档的编辑效率。
2025-09-17 20:32:25
425人看过